Madanlal Bhati, Chairman of the Rajasthan OBC Commission, extends greetings on National Legal Services Day

National Legal Services Day is a powerful redressal mechanism for building an equitable society: Madanlal Bhati, Chairman, OBC Commission

Jaipur, November 9, Justice (Retd.) Madanlal Bhati, Chairman of the Rajasthan State Other Backward Classes (Political Representation) Commission, Government of Rajasthan, extended greetings to the people of the state on the occasion of National Legal Services Day. Vikram Rathore, Public Relations Officer of the OBC Commission, Govt. of Rajasthan, stated that in his message, Mr. Bhati said that National Legal Services Day is celebrated every year on November 9 to commemorate the constitutional provisions for providing free and efficient legal services to marginalized and disadvantaged sections of society. India is the world’s largest democracy. The Constitution of India guarantees every citizen equal rights and equal protection under the law. Legal Services Authorities were established under the Legal Services Authorities Act, 1987 to provide free and competent legal services to marginalized and disadvantaged sections of society. The fundamental principle of legal aid is that no citizen, regardless of financial or other constraints, should be denied an equal opportunity to access justice. National Legal Services Day provides an opportunity to raise awareness about legal rights and responsibilities, empower citizens to seek justice in a fair and dignified manner, and serves as a platform to ensure access to justice for all. The day aims to educate people about their legal rights and promote redressal mechanisms to build a more equitable society. Today reminds us that justice must be equal and accessible to all.
